Warehouse Material Handler
Warehouse Material Handler is responsible for picking, packing, and all physical and system material movements which support the warehouse activities. These activities include, but are not limited to, FIFO inventory movements, processing shipments, locating inbound materials, cycle counting, and all system corresponding transactions. All activities support annual targets in line with business order fill, case fill, inventory accuracy, gross sales volume, and manufacturing production requirements. Material Handlers will also be accountable for the accuracy of material financial system integrity.
Responsibilities :
- Maintains safe, clean, and orderly work environment at all times.
- Loads materials onto vehicles, installs strapping, bracing, or padding to prevent damage while in transit.
- Safely moves, loads, and unloads product to and from pallet racks with MHE above or below ground.
- Reads orders and / or follows oral instructions to meet scheduled activities as directed.
- Receives materials and verifies materials against packing lists to ensure the accuracy of the delivery.
- Works effectively in a team environment and demonstrates flexibility in all assigned tasks.
- Communicates effectively, reads, and interprets documents such as safety rules, operating policies, maintenance instructions, and procedure manuals.
- Wears personal protective equipment as required for the job.
- Operates and drives gasoline-, liquefied gas-, or electric-powered industrial trucks equipped with lifting devices, such as forklift, boom, scoop, lift beam, and swivel-hook, fork-grapple, clamps, elevating platform, or trailer hitch, to push, pull, lift, stack, tier, or locate, relocate, and stack products, equipment, or materials in warehouse or storage locations.
- Supports the processing of all sales orders and / or outbound requests daily to meet customer expectations and business order fill targets and KPIs.
- Rotates materials for shipments and storage with regard to FIFO.
- Works with team (vendors, planning, production managers, quality, and staff) to ensure optimum efficiency within the order fulfillment process.
